
For the third year in a row, Equity has received the Visa Top Acquirer Award during the Visa 2019 Awards ceremony held in Nairobi. The award recognizes the bank that has recorded the highest point of sale payment volumes in the year.
While receiving the award, Equity Group director of payments, Adeyinka Adedeji, noted that it came at an opportune time when the bank has embarked on educating customers about the benefits of cashless payments.
“We are indeed delighted to receive the Visa 2019 Top Acquirer Award. It demonstrates our focus and commitment to providing our customers with top of the market payment channels that are reliable, secure and convenient,” said Adeyinka. Currently, Equity is leading in acquiring and issuing, with more than 20,000 merchants in Kenya alone, offering the best in class payment channel services that are interoperable for merchants.
During its 2019 quarter three results, Equity registered a 35% increase in merchant transaction volumes, from 12.7 million in 2018 Q3 to 17.1 million. The merchant transaction value grew by 27% from Kshs. 69.6 billion in 2018 Q3 to Kshs. 88.4 billion.
